Why Gaggenau Steam Ovens Need Specialized Repair
Gaggenau is a German-engineered, ultra-premium appliance brand under BSH (Bosch and Siemens Home Appliances). Its steam ovens aren’t built like standard wall ovens; they use external steam generation, precision water inlet systems, electronic door locks, and touch-control boards that require brand-specific diagnostic tools to service correctly.
A generalist technician without Gaggenau-specific training can misdiagnose a simple descaling issue as a full control board failure, or damage a steam generator by using the wrong service procedure. That’s why Gaggenau repair should always go to a technician with documented experience with the brand, not a general appliance repair call.
Common Gaggenau Steam Oven Problems
Based on the repair calls we see most often across Los Angeles, here are the issues that bring Gaggenau steam oven owners to a technician:
Oven Won’t Generate Steam
Usually caused by mineral scale buildup in the steam generator — especially common in areas with hard water, which affects a large share of the Greater Los Angeles water supply. A clogged steam nozzle or failed heating element can also be the cause.
Water Pooling in the Cavity or Leaking
Often a sign of a failed door seal or gasket, a cracked water inlet hose, or a steam generator that isn’t draining correctly between cycles.
Error Codes / Control Panel Malfunctions
Gaggenau’s touch-control and TFT display systems can throw fault codes tied to the water detection sensor, the electronic door lock, or the main control board. These codes are brand-specific and require Gaggenau diagnostic software to read accurately.
Slow Preheat or Inconsistent Temperature
If preheat takes noticeably longer than it used to, scale buildup on the steam boiler is frequently the culprit. Left untreated, this can eventually damage the heating element.
Door Won’t Lock or Open
Gaggenau steam ovens use an electronic door lock for safety during high-pressure steam cycles. A failed lock mechanism or sensor can prevent the door from opening or closing properly.
Unusual Noises or Water Detection Errors
Water with a total dissolved solids reading under 100 ppm TDS can trigger false water-detection faults on newer Gaggenau models – a detail many non-specialist technicians miss entirely.

Repair vs. Replace: Making the Right Call
A useful rule of thumb in the appliance industry is the 50/50 rule: if the repair cost is more than 50% of the appliance’s replacement value and the unit is past roughly half its expected lifespan, replacement may make more financial sense.
For a Gaggenau steam oven, that math almost always favors repair. Even a control board replacement, the most expensive single repair, rarely approaches 50% of what a new Gaggenau unit costs. Combined with the brand’s engineering longevity, most steam oven issues are worth fixing rather than replacing.
